Location: Since October 1996, the German Youth Hostel Association has taken over the approximately 20 hectare site of the former Navy Seamanship Training Group. It is located between the ferry port, the Wadden Sea and the sheltered harbor in the south of the island. It takes just under 15 minutes to get to town by bus and island train, and about 30 minutes by bike.
Accommodation: There are shared rooms, but also single and double rooms. In total there are 700 beds in 169 rooms.
Target group: Due to its size, the hostel Borkum It's particularly suitable for school classes, sports groups, conferences and seminars, and recreational retreats. And it's also a practical advantage that larger groups can often find accommodation here at short notice.
Meals: There is a breakfast buffet from 07:30 to 09:00, daily vegetarian dishes, gluten-free dishes on request and a microwave.
Equipment: In the youth hostel on Borkum There's a beach volleyball court, a soccer field, a covered barbecue area, and even a bowling alley. Wi-Fi, a washing machine, dryer, and parking are also available.
